/* CSS Document */
body{ background-color:#B6D2E6; margin:0;}

td
{font-family:tahoma; font-size:11px; color:#000000; line-height:18px;}

.tdcaption{ background-color:#286298; color:#FFFFFF; font-weight:bold; text-align:center}

.bggrey{ background-color:#B4B4B4;}

.tdhead { font-family:tahoma; font-size:11px; font-weight:bold; text-decoration:none; color:#595959;}

.tdsmall{ font-size:10px;}

.tdhint { font-family:tahoma; font-weight:bold; font-size:11px; color:#FFFFFF;}

.bluetxt { font-family:tahoma; font-size:11px; color:#286298; }

.tdblue{font-family:Tahoma;font-size:12px;font-weight:bold;color:#286298; background-color: #EAF7FF}

.tdbhead { font-family:tahoma; font-size:11px; color:#C3E4FA; }

.tdwhite{font-family: Arial, Helvetica, sans-serif;	font-size:12px;	font-weight:bold;color:#FFFFFF;padding-left: 2px;}

.tdlmhead {font-family:tahoma; font-size:11px; font-weight:bold; text-decoration:none;  color:#000000;}

.tdcontent{font-family:tahoma; font-size:11px; color:#000000 line-height:18px; text-align:justify;}

.shade1{ background-color:#E1EFF9}

.shade2{ background-color:#C5E0F3}

.shade3{ background-color:#B2D6EF}

.padding_left{padding-left:20px;}

.padding_top{padding-left:20px;padding-top:20px;}

.tdtestimonial {font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 12px;	font-style: italic;	color: #003399;	line-height: 18px;	text-align: justify;}

.tdred{font-family: Verdana, Arial, Helvetica, sans-serif;color:#c70000; }

.tdnews{ background-color:#f4f9ff; border:#d3dcea solid 1px;}

.rightalign{font-family:Verdana, Arial, Helvetica, sans-serif;color:#000000; text-align:right;}

.sitemap {border-bottom-style: dotted;border-bottom-color: #CCCCCC;padding-left: 5px;border-bottom-width: thin;	padding-top: 4px;
	padding-bottom: 4px;}

a{color:#286298;text-decoration:underline;}
a:hover	{color:#70A6CC;text-decoration:none;}

a.menu{ font-family:tahoma; font-size:11px; color:#000000; text-decoration:none;}
a.menu:hover{ font-family:tahoma; font-size:11px; color:#000000; text-decoration:none;}

a.menuleft{ font-family:tahoma; font-size:11px; color:#000000; text-decoration:none;}
a.menuleft:hover{ font-family:tahoma; font-size:11px; color:#000000; text-decoration:underline;}

a.lnkblue{ font-family:tahoma; font-size:11px; color:#286298; text-decoration:none;}
a.lnkblue:hover{ font-family:tahoma; font-size:11px; color:#286298; text-decoration:underline;}

a.red{ font-family:tahoma; font-size:11px; color:#c70000; text-decoration:underline;}
a.red:hover{ font-family:tahoma; font-size:11px; color:#c70000; text-decoration:none;}

a.menubtm
{ font-family:tahoma; font-weight:bold; font-size:11px; color:#FFFFFF; text-decoration:none;}

a.menubtm:hover
{ font-family:tahoma; font-weight:bold; font-size:11px; color:#4D4D4D; text-decoration:none;}

a.tmenu
{ font-family:tahoma; font-weight:bold; font-size:11px; color:#000000; text-decoration:none;}

a.tmenu:hover
{ font-family:tahoma; font-weight:bold; font-size:11px; color:#000000; text-decoration:underline;}

a.smlinks
{ font-family:tahoma;font-size:11px; color:#000000; text-decoration:none;}

a.smlinks:hover
{ font-family:tahoma; font-size:11px; color:#006699; text-decoration:underline;}

.tblborder {
	border: 1px solid #FFFFFF;
}
.tdpadding {
	padding-right: 20px;
	padding-left: 5px;
	text-align:justify;
}
.tdjustify {
	text-align: justify;
}

.txtbox
{ background-color:#FFFFFF; border: solid 1px #CCCCCC; width:170px;}

.txtbox1
{ background-color:#FFFFFF; border: solid 1px #CCCCCC;}

.txtbox2
{ background-color:#FFFFFF; border: solid 1px #CCCCCC; width:170px; height:24px;}

.button{background-color:#286298; border:1px solid #003366; color:FFFFFF; font-size:11px;}

.button1{background-color:#286298; border:1px thin #003366; color:FFFFFF; font-size:13px;}

#navlist
{
margin: 0;
padding: 10px 0 40px 0;

}

#navlist ul, #navlist li
{
margin: 0;
padding: 0;
display: inline;
list-style-type: none;
}

#navlist a:link, #navlist a:visited
{
float: left;
line-height: 14px;
font-weight: bold;
margin: 0 10px 4px 10px;
text-decoration: none;
color: #70a6cc;
}

#navlist a:link#current, #navlist a:visited#current, #navlist a:hover
{
border-bottom: 4px solid #286298;
padding-bottom: 2px;
background: transparent;
color: #286298;
}

#navlist a:hover { color: #286298; }
